Webentwicklungs-Kurse können Ihnen helfen zu lernen, wie Webseiten und Webanwendungen aufgebaut werden. Sie können Fähigkeiten in HTML, CSS, JavaScript, Frameworks und Serverlogik aufbauen. Viele Kurse nutzen Projektbeispiele und Tools, um moderne Webentwicklung verständlich zu machen.

Northeastern University
Kompetenzen, die Sie erwerben: Systems Thinking, Software Visualization, Object Oriented Design, Software Engineering, Object Oriented Programming (OOP), Project Risk Management, Application Design, Web Applications, Software Development Life Cycle, Risk Management, Case Studies, Web Development, Software Development Methodologies, Application Development, Program Development, Python Programming, Application Frameworks, Software Design, Programming Principles, Computer Programming
★ 2.6 (17) · Anfänger · Spezialisierung · 3–6 Monate

Scrimba
Kompetenzen, die Sie erwerben: JSON, UI Components, Application Deployment, Data Import/Export, Code Reusability, Web Frameworks, Web Design and Development, Front-End Web Development, Web Development Tools, Full-Stack Web Development, Web Development, HTML and CSS, Frontend Performance, Content Management, Cascading Style Sheets (CSS), Application Frameworks, Javascript, File Management
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Ereignisgesteuerte Programmierung, Web-Entwicklung, Benutzerfreundliches Design, Datenverwaltung, Cascading Style Sheets (CSS), Benutzeroberfläche (UI), Javascript, Datenmanagement, Front-End-Webentwicklung, JavaScript-Frameworks, Anwendungsprogrammierschnittstelle (API), React.js, UI-Komponenten, Frontend-Integration
Mittel · Kurs · 1–4 Wochen

Red Hat
Kompetenzen, die Sie erwerben: Object Oriented Programming (OOP), File I/O, JSON, Python Programming, Debugging, Object Oriented Design, Data Structures, Red Hat Enterprise Linux, Programming Principles, Statistical Programming, Web Development, Program Development, Scripting, Integrated Development Environments, Development Environment, Software Installation
Mittel · Kurs · 3–6 Monate

Kompetenzen, die Sie erwerben: Web-Entwicklung, Containerisierung, Server-Seite, MongoDB, Bereitstellung von Anwendungen, Datenbanken, Restful API, Kontinuierliche Bereitstellung, Kontinuierliche Integration, Kubernetes, CI/CD, Back-End-Webentwicklung, JavaScript-Frameworks, Full-Stack Web-Entwicklung, API-Entwurf, Microservices, Node.JS, NoSQL, Technische Überprüfung der Software, Frontend-Integration
★ 4.6 (10) · Fortgeschritten · Kurs · 1–3 Monate

Scrimba
Kompetenzen, die Sie erwerben: Software Design Patterns, Computational Thinking, Software Design, Algorithms, Program Development, Theoretical Computer Science, Software Development, Programming Principles, Computer Programming, Problem Solving, Software Engineering, Data Structures, Computer Science, Javascript, Web Development, Machine Learning Methods, Data Science
Mittel · Spezialisierung · 1–4 Wochen

Kompetenzen, die Sie erwerben: Wiederverwendbarkeit von Code, Web-Entwicklung, Javascript, Front-End-Webentwicklung, React.js
Mittel · angeleitetes Projekt · Weniger als 2 Stunden

Coursera
Kompetenzen, die Sie erwerben: Web-Entwicklung, HTML und CSS, Cascading Style Sheets (CSS), Skripting, Javascript, Front-End-Webentwicklung, Hypertext Markup Language (HTML), Web-Design
Anfänger · angeleitetes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: Restful API, API Design, GitHub, Git (Version Control System), Postman API Platform, Application Programming Interface (API), Version Control, Application Deployment, API Testing, Web Development, Full-Stack Web Development, Back-End Web Development, Web Applications, Front-End Web Development
Mittel ·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Selenium (Software), JUnit, HTML and CSS, Test Automation, Hypertext Markup Language (HTML), Software Testing, Web Design and Development, Test Script Development, Test Tools, Web Development, Unit Testing, Software Quality Assurance, Java, Data Structures, Java Programming, Cascading Style Sheets (CSS), Test Execution Engine, Code Reusability, Debugging, Software Design Patterns
Mittel · Kurs · 1–3 Monate

Kompetenzen, die Sie erwerben: Angular, Model View Controller, Web Applications, JavaScript Frameworks, Data Validation, Application Frameworks, Javascript, Application Development, Web Development
★ 4.6 (7) · Mittel · angeleitetes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: Computer Programmierung, Web-Entwicklung, Computerprogrammierung, Javascript, Rechnerische Logik, Grundsätze der Programmierung, Anwendungsentwicklung
Anfänger · angeleitetes Projekt · Weniger als 2 Stunden